Problems solved by technology

The traditional method is to switch the scheme by replacing parts. When new location verification requirements arise, temporary additional processing and manufacturing of replacement parts is required. The manufacturing cycle is long and the development progress is delayed. When switching the layout scheme by means of adjustment, each step of adjustment requires Complicated position calibration, when the schemes are repeatedly switched and compared, the site needs to wait for a long time, the user experience is poor, and the immediacy of the layout scheme determination cannot be satisfied
[0004] In the prior art, the motor-driven adjustment is commonly used, supplemented by a scale to record the position on the degree of freedom of the position adjustment. When this method is used, each adjustment of the degree of freedom requires cumbersome position calibration. The adjustment process is complicated, the site needs to wait for a long time, the user experience is poor, and the immediacy of the layout plan cannot be satisfied

Abstract

The invention provides a passenger car man-machine verification cabin intelligent adjusting system based on WIFI communication control. The system comprises a mobile terminal, a passenger car man-machine verification cabin intelligent adjusting system and a passenger car man-machine verification cabin intelligent adjusting system, the microcontroller is in WIFI communication with the mobile terminal and receives a control instruction which is sent by the mobile terminal and contains function selection; the degree-of-freedom driving circuit array is electrically coupled with the microcontroller and is used for receiving and executing the control instruction of the mobile terminal; wherein the function selection comprises zeroing calibration, vehicle type one-key switching, fine tuning control, and switching comparison between a recorded data position and a theoretical data position. The system has a more convenient adjustment mode, and can realize control functions of one-key switching among different vehicle types of each degree of freedom of the man-machine verification cabin, fine adjustment of different degrees of freedom of the same vehicle type, recording of different arrangement schemes, rapid switching comparison and the like. The real-time requirement for determining the man-machine verification arrangement scheme is met, and the development risk is reduced.

Description

technical field [0001] The invention mainly relates to the field of layout of passenger cars, in particular to an intelligent adjustment control system and method for passenger car man-machine verification cockpit based on WIFI communication control. Background technique [0002] In the process of automobile research and development, it is a very important development link to provide users with a high-quality driving and riding environment under the premise of complying with road regulations. In line with the principles of human-centered design, the layout of the cockpit must conform to ergonomics. [0003] If the layout plan is uncertain in the early stage of development or changed in the later stage, the development cycle will be extended, the development cost will increase, and the market launch strategy of the product will be affected.
